Skip to content

Instantly share code, notes, and snippets.

@solarkennedy
Created February 27, 2025 17:28
Show Gist options
  • Save solarkennedy/13c5b276dcf3f96915d091ff18045535 to your computer and use it in GitHub Desktop.
Save solarkennedy/13c5b276dcf3f96915d091ff18045535 to your computer and use it in GitHub Desktop.
Palm PVG-100 (Pepito) Partition Layout and Sizes
modem -> /dev/block/mmcblk0p1
fsc -> /dev/block/mmcblk0p2
ssd -> /dev/block/mmcblk0p3
sbl1 -> /dev/block/mmcblk0p4
sbl1bak -> /dev/block/mmcblk0p5
rpm -> /dev/block/mmcblk0p6
rpmbak -> /dev/block/mmcblk0p7
tz -> /dev/block/mmcblk0p8
tzbak -> /dev/block/mmcblk0p9
devcfg -> /dev/block/mmcblk0p10
devcfgbak -> /dev/block/mmcblk0p11
dsp -> /dev/block/mmcblk0p12
modemst1 -> /dev/block/mmcblk0p13
modemst2 -> /dev/block/mmcblk0p14
DDR -> /dev/block/mmcblk0p15
fsg -> /dev/block/mmcblk0p16
sec -> /dev/block/mmcblk0p17
tunning -> /dev/block/mmcblk0p18
traceability -> /dev/block/mmcblk0p19
simlock -> /dev/block/mmcblk0p20
redbend -> /dev/block/mmcblk0p21
splash -> /dev/block/mmcblk0p22
aboot -> /dev/block/mmcblk0p23
abootbak -> /dev/block/mmcblk0p24
boot -> /dev/block/mmcblk0p25
recovery -> /dev/block/mmcblk0p26
system -> /dev/block/mmcblk0p27
vendor -> /dev/block/mmcblk0p28
cache -> /dev/block/mmcblk0p29
persist -> /dev/block/mmcblk0p30
devinfo -> /dev/block/mmcblk0p31
misc -> /dev/block/mmcblk0p32
keystore -> /dev/block/mmcblk0p33
config -> /dev/block/mmcblk0p34
oem -> /dev/block/mmcblk0p35
limits -> /dev/block/mmcblk0p36
mota -> /dev/block/mmcblk0p37
dip -> /dev/block/mmcblk0p38
mdtp -> /dev/block/mmcblk0p39
syscfg -> /dev/block/mmcblk0p40
mcfg -> /dev/block/mmcblk0p41
cmnlib -> /dev/block/mmcblk0p42
cmnlibbak -> /dev/block/mmcblk0p43
cmnlib64 -> /dev/block/mmcblk0p44
cmnlib64bak -> /dev/block/mmcblk0p45
keymaster -> /dev/block/mmcblk0p46
keymasterbak -> /dev/block/mmcblk0p47
apdp -> /dev/block/mmcblk0p48
msadp -> /dev/block/mmcblk0p49
dpo -> /dev/block/mmcblk0p50
logdump -> /dev/block/mmcblk0p51
fotadata -> /dev/block/mmcblk0p52
userdata -> /dev/block/mmcblk0p53
/dev/block/mmcblk0p1 -> modem
/dev/block/mmcblk0p2 -> fsc
/dev/block/mmcblk0p3 -> ssd
/dev/block/mmcblk0p4 -> sbl1
/dev/block/mmcblk0p5 -> sbl1bak
/dev/block/mmcblk0p6 -> rpm
/dev/block/mmcblk0p7 -> rpmbak
/dev/block/mmcblk0p8 -> tz
/dev/block/mmcblk0p9 -> tzbak
/dev/block/mmcblk0p10 -> devcfg
/dev/block/mmcblk0p11 -> devcfgbak
/dev/block/mmcblk0p12 -> dsp
/dev/block/mmcblk0p13 -> modemst1
/dev/block/mmcblk0p14 -> modemst2
/dev/block/mmcblk0p15 -> DDR
/dev/block/mmcblk0p16 -> fsg
/dev/block/mmcblk0p17 -> sec
/dev/block/mmcblk0p18 -> tunning
/dev/block/mmcblk0p19 -> traceability
/dev/block/mmcblk0p20 -> simlock
/dev/block/mmcblk0p21 -> redbend
/dev/block/mmcblk0p22 -> splash
/dev/block/mmcblk0p23 -> aboot
/dev/block/mmcblk0p24 -> abootbak
/dev/block/mmcblk0p25 -> boot
/dev/block/mmcblk0p26 -> recovery
/dev/block/mmcblk0p27 -> system
/dev/block/mmcblk0p28 -> vendor
/dev/block/mmcblk0p29 -> cache
/dev/block/mmcblk0p30 -> persist
/dev/block/mmcblk0p31 -> devinfo
/dev/block/mmcblk0p32 -> misc
/dev/block/mmcblk0p33 -> keystore
/dev/block/mmcblk0p34 -> config
/dev/block/mmcblk0p35 -> oem
/dev/block/mmcblk0p36 -> limits
/dev/block/mmcblk0p37 -> mota
/dev/block/mmcblk0p38 -> dip
/dev/block/mmcblk0p39 -> mdtp
/dev/block/mmcblk0p40 -> syscfg
/dev/block/mmcblk0p41 -> mcfg
/dev/block/mmcblk0p42 -> cmnlib
/dev/block/mmcblk0p43 -> cmnlibbak
/dev/block/mmcblk0p44 -> cmnlib64
/dev/block/mmcblk0p45 -> cmnlib64bak
/dev/block/mmcblk0p46 -> keymaster
/dev/block/mmcblk0p47 -> keymasterbak
/dev/block/mmcblk0p48 -> apdp
/dev/block/mmcblk0p49 -> msadp
/dev/block/mmcblk0p50 -> dpo
/dev/block/mmcblk0p51 -> logdump
/dev/block/mmcblk0p52 -> fotadata
/dev/block/mmcblk0p53 -> userdata
# 1024 byte blocks!
/dev/block/bootdevice/by-name # cat /proc/partitions
major minor #blocks name
179 0 30535680 mmcblk0
179 1 86016 mmcblk0p1
179 2 1 mmcblk0p2
179 3 8 mmcblk0p3
179 4 512 mmcblk0p4
179 5 512 mmcblk0p5
179 6 512 mmcblk0p6
179 7 512 mmcblk0p7
179 8 2048 mmcblk0p8
179 9 2048 mmcblk0p9
179 10 256 mmcblk0p10
179 11 256 mmcblk0p11
179 12 16384 mmcblk0p12
179 13 1536 mmcblk0p13
179 14 1536 mmcblk0p14
179 15 32 mmcblk0p15
179 16 1536 mmcblk0p16
179 17 16 mmcblk0p17
179 18 1536 mmcblk0p18
179 19 1024 mmcblk0p19
179 20 1024 mmcblk0p20
179 21 3096 mmcblk0p21
179 22 11264 mmcblk0p22
179 23 1024 mmcblk0p23
179 24 1024 mmcblk0p24
179 25 65536 mmcblk0p25
179 26 65536 mmcblk0p26
179 27 3145728 mmcblk0p27
179 28 1572864 mmcblk0p28
179 29 262144 mmcblk0p29
179 30 32768 mmcblk0p30
179 31 1024 mmcblk0p31
259 0 1024 mmcblk0p32
259 1 512 mmcblk0p33
259 2 32 mmcblk0p34
259 3 262144 mmcblk0p35
259 4 32 mmcblk0p36
259 5 512 mmcblk0p37
259 6 1024 mmcblk0p38
259 7 32768 mmcblk0p39
259 8 512 mmcblk0p40
259 9 4096 mmcblk0p41
259 10 1024 mmcblk0p42
259 11 1024 mmcblk0p43
259 12 1024 mmcblk0p44
259 13 1024 mmcblk0p45
259 14 1024 mmcblk0p46
259 15 1024 mmcblk0p47
259 16 256 mmcblk0p48
259 17 256 mmcblk0p49
259 18 8 mmcblk0p50
259 19 65536 mmcblk0p51
259 20 2097152 mmcblk0p52
259 21 22146535 mmcblk0p53
179 32 4096 mmcblk0rpmb
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ment